<p>David and I go back over 10 years. We first met through my friends in Vertical Horizon and we remain close to this day. He has shot two of my album covers, (Save Me and No Wrong Way…), captured thousands of amazing tour shots, backstage moments and Down The Hatch events. He has been a huge part of what you see from PMB over the last decade and I hope many more to come. He is an extremely accomplished photographer having taken shots for everything from professional sports (a 11 time and counting Sports Illustrated cover shots), music (lately he’s been Bon Jovi’s main guy) and even politics having shot President Obama’s historic and groundbreaking Gigapan shot.  Check out (<a href="http://www.davidbergman.net" target="_blank">davidbergman.net</a>) for all his amazing work. I am proud to call him my friend and humbled that he takes time to shoot lil’ ole PMB. 			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Disclaimer: These guys are my friends and played on my latest record. But that doesn’t mean I will like their record just because we are old school mates.</p>
<p>It has some of the best writing SK and the boys have done to date. They always make records that make you THAT much closer to knowing Stephen as an artist, man and father. He’s prolific, well read, quite intelligent, and a very caring individual. These attributes shine through on Gift Horse. Stephen has a knack for making you really want to pay close attention to what he’s singing about; the listener hangs on every word and he respects that. The band sounds great. Boots, Kit and Sam are all contributing fantastically hooky and tasteful parts to give each song the lift or space they need. It’s all about serving the song and not the ego of the musician recording it. When that’s done delicately and with restraint, the ego will get its due. It’s hard to pick my favorite tunes. Each one tells a different story and does so with infectious melodies and vocal parts that are purely honest. I know first-hand how hard it is to put out a record that’s different from your previous work. The judgments start flying around and you pray people will give it a chance. Gift Horse is one of those records that will grow on you. In the end it will be one of your favorite albums that you return to over and over. Well done, fellahs.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>I love ALL of Bob’s records. We had the pleasure of playing a few shows together in TX way back when…nobody does it like Bob does. He is an alien and I fear him. I watched him silence a room in St Louis on night with his talents as well as when he handed cash back to some obnoxious attendees and told them to leave. His tunes are lyrically amazing; he’s crazy talented on many instruments and has a knack for always being cooler than you. We need him. He’s the guy on the Dos Equis commercials if he made records. This album is typical Bob but like all his records, very unique. The effortless pure vocal tone he produces is hauntingly awesome. The songs on this one all stand-alone and get under your skin like a killer massage. Get this record and be slightly cooler than you were yesterday. Enjoy.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>I have been waiting for his third release. I’ve been slightly obsessed with James and his whole thang since his first record. I’ve seen him solo, trio and full band…and in NYC I was moved to tears during “Once When I Was Little”. It’s just what happens when you have kids and you let lyrics really touch a nerve (and maaaaaybe had a few glasses of vino in me). Either way, he’s an unreal live performer and I can’t wait to catch him when he returns with this new album. I love a record that has a vibe that is consistent throughout. It’s a touch throwback but uniquely James. You can tell how much he loved Stevie Wonder and other Motown greats. He’s the real deal. There are some upbeat jams on here that really show a new side of JM. I’m pretty sure I have never heard him sing about being a “Slave To The Music” prior to this album. The parts are stellar and the instrumentation is raw and classic. Like all new records with me, they take several listens to really hear the story the artist is telling. I guess it’s kinda like how I try to make my kids eat foods they “hate” at least 10 times before they can claim to actually indeed “hate” it. (You can’t live on pancakes last I checked.) James Morrison is a never-ending buffet of melody and groove. Enjoy.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>I can’t say enough about this amazing property. It’s the best thing going as far as I’m concerned. Every room has breathtaking yet calming views of the San Francisco Bay as well as the city skyline. It seems whenever I go, the weather is perfect, the breeze off the bay is so good for the soul and the sounds of the water just outside your room will make even an award winning insomniac sleep for days. The rooms have fireplaces and big ole tubs to soak in. When you’re chillin’ on your own private deck you will most likely see seals surfacing and majestic sailboats circling the bay. The town of Sausalito is one, if not my favorite in the country. I fell in love with it during the Shine record. We lived out there for months. It just has something to it, hard to explain. The restaurants are walking distance and if you really must hit San Fran, it’s a short drive over the Goldie Gate. I’ll be honest, you should go with someone your madly in love with, just sayin’. It’s the kind of hotel you don’t ever want to leave the room, there is no need <img src='http://www.patmcgee.net/wp-includes/images/smilies/icon_wink.gif' alt=';)' class='wp-smiley' />  Maybe one day we’ll do a high end Down The Hatch out there. We shall see, either way, go! Enjoy.</p>
